Significant Changes in Industrial Activities
Within the past eight years, the Roxboro facility has installed a new truck dumper and wood
conveyor system in Drainage Area 4, and the facility has increased the quantity of wood fuel that
is handled and stored on -site. The stormwater from this drainage area flows into an intermittent
stream that flows onto plant property from the south, and then exits plant property to the north,
just outside the northern property boundary. Also, a new double -walled 1,000-gallon storage
tank is used to dispense diesel fuel. This tank is located on the Cooling Tower Pad.
An earlier version of the site's Stormwater Pollution Prevention Plan (SWPPP) referred to two
internal stormwater outfalls, 002 and 003, in Drainage Area 4. However, construction of the new
truck dumper added new plant roads and resulted in significant topography changes in this
drainage area, creating two new internal stormwater outfalls which replaced Outfalls 002 and
003. The on -site wastewater basin discharge is covered by a different NPDES permit, and
discharges through Wastewater Outfall 003.
To avoid confusion, the site has assigned the numbers 002 and 004 to the new stormwater
outfalls located within the site boundary. These internal outfalls are included in the revised Site
Map. Both 002 and 004 ultimately discharge through an outfall located offsite for which Capital
Power has no access for sampling purposes.
Because of potential contamination associated with runoff from adjacent properties for which
Capital Power has no control into stormwater outfalls 002 and 004, we are proposing to continue
to collect analytical samples only at stormwater outfall 001 which discharges offsite.
Stormwater outfalls 002 and 004 will be qualitatively monitored visually, and site activities in
surrounding drainage areas will continue to follow Best Management Practices (BMP's) to
reduce impacts to offsite outfall discharge.

BMP Summary
Table A, below, summarizes the BMPs used at the Roxboro plant
Potentially exposed materials at the Roxboro plant include coal, wood chips, tire derived fuel (TDF),
petroleum products stored in existing ASTs, water treatment chemicals, limestone, and ash.
Coal for the boiler plant is stored outside in the coal pile and coal pile runoff is treated in the low
volume wastewater system prior to discharge (i.e., it is not drained to the stormwater system). Coal is
brought in by rail at the west end of the plant and unloaded periodically through the coal chute and
transported via conveyor belt to the coal pile. The risk of coal dust entering the storm water via
fugitive dust exists and to minimize that risk, coal unloading BMPs are used and, because the drainage
adjacent to the rail bed is through vegetative buffers, the quantity of coal reaching the receiving water
is minimal. Water is sprayed, as needed, onto the coal as it is unloaded from the rail cars in one of the
coal unloading BMPs. Also, coal dust from the edges of the chute where coal is deposited is swept up
daily after unloading operations. These BMPs, coupled with the comparatively limited surface area
draining to the stormwater system in the western plant site, minimize fugitive dust transport.
The risk of the petroleum products entering the storm system is low due to the use of secondary
containment that conforms to 40 CFR 112.8(c)(2) and non-structural controls (e.g., routine
inspections) to prevent spills. Used oil is stored in two 300-gallon aboveground storage tanks (ASTs)
located at the Oil Storage Area. The used oil recycling vendor removes the used oil as needed. Diesel
is stored in a 300-gallon AST inside the Pump House and in a 1,000 gallon double -walled tank on the
Cooling Tower Pad. Diesel, gasoline, and kerosene are each stored in 300-gallon ASTs located Oil
Storage Area. There are dedicated unloading bays at both the Oil Storage Area and the Pump House
which are used during oil loading/unloading operations.
The several chemical storage units in the Demineralizer Building are all equipped with secondary
containment. Any spills would be routed to the Neutralization Tank and then the Wastewater Basin
for treatment. There is a dedicated unloading bay at the Demineralizer Building, and spill materials are
located inside the building. The Cooling Tower Chemical Building also has chemical storage areas
with a dedicated secondary containment pad, and any overflow from this pad would enter the
"V-ditch" leading to the Wastewater Basin.
The risk of ash or ash residue entering the storm system is low due to the use of non-structural controls
(i.e. an ash curtain and periodic sweeping/cleaning of the area). Each ash loading system is equipped
with a Dustmaster, which is a device designed to minimize fugitive dust due to the ash loading. When
the ash loading is complete, the ash loading area floor is manually swept/cleaned to avoid the tracking
of ash residue.
The risk of limestone entering the storm system is low due to the use of structural and non-structural
controls (i.e. the limestone silo and its blowers and piping are sealed, and limestone is removed from
equipment prior to maintenance). Limestone is pneumatically conveyed in closed lines. Any spills of
limestone will be promptly cleaned up.
Wood chips and TDF may spill from the truck dumper, conveyors, and radial stacker. The risk
of these materials contaminating stormwater is low due to the use of automatic sumps beneath
the truck dumper which convey accumulated stormwater to the Wastewater Basin. because
spilled materials are promptly cleaned up, and the paved areas are periodically swept.

Significant Changes in Industrial Activities
Within the past six years, the Roxboro facility has installed a new truck dumper and wood
conveyor system in Drainage Area 4, and the facility has increased the quantity of wood fuel that
is handled and stored on -site. The stormwater from this drainage area sheet flows into an
intermittent creek that flows to the west, just inside the northern property boundary. Also, a new
double -walled 1,000-gallon storage tank is used to dispense diesel fuel. This tank is located on
the Cooling Tower Pad.
An earlier version of the site's Stormwater Pollution Prevention Plan (SWPPP) referred to two
internal stormwater outfalls, 002 and 003, in Drainage Area 4. However, the stormwater from
these outfalls flows into an underground culvert through a drop inlet, where it combines with the
discharge from the on -site wastewater treatment plant prior to discharge off -site. The discharge
from the on -site wastewater treatment plant is covered by a different NPDES permit. As such, to
avoid confusion, the two internal stormwater outfalls are not shown in the site's current SWPPP,
nor are they shown on the enclosed Site Map.
